Frequently Asked Questions About Insurance in Beacon

What are the minimum auto insurance requirements for drivers in Beacon, NY?

In Beacon, New York, drivers must carry liability insurance with minimums of $25,000 for bodily injury per person, $50,000 for bodily injury per accident, and $10,000 for property damage. These are New York state requirements, but given Beacon's proximity to major highways like I-84 and Route 9D, many residents opt for higher coverage limits to protect against increased accident risks.

How does living in a Hudson Valley flood zone affect home insurance in Beacon?

Beacon's location along the Hudson River places many properties in flood-prone areas, particularly near the waterfront and creeks. Standard home insurance policies do not cover flood damage, so residents in designated flood zones should purchase separate flood insurance through the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P). Given Beacon's history of flooding, this coverage is essential for protecting your home and belongings.

How do Beacon's historic homes impact home insurance premiums and coverage?

Beacon's many historic homes, especially in districts like the Beacon Historic District, often require specialized insurance due to unique architectural features and higher rebuilding costs. Standard policies may not fully cover custom materials or historic restoration, so owners should seek policies that include extended replacement cost and ordinance or law coverage. Working with an insurer experienced in historic properties can ensure adequate protection.

Navigating House Insurance Companies in Beacon, New York: A Local Homeowner's Guide

Finding the right house insurance companies in Beacon, New York, requires a nuanced understanding of our unique Hudson Valley community. Beacon's blend of historic architecture, from Victorian homes to renovated factory lofts, and its proximity to both natural landscapes and urban influences creates specific insurance considerations. As a homeowner here, you're not just protecting a structure; you're safeguarding a piece of the city's vibrant character against risks that are particular to our region. The process begins with recognizing that not all house insurance companies are equally familiar with the local landscape, making informed selection crucial. Beacon's location along the Hudson River and within the Hudson Highlands presents distinct environmental factors. While major flooding from the river is less common in the city proper compared to lower-lying areas, heavy rainfall and storm runoff from Mount Beacon and the surrounding hills can lead to basement water intrusion or localized flooding. A knowledgeable house insurance company will understand these micro-risks and ensure your policy includes adequate water backup coverage, which is often a separate endorsement. Furthermore, the area's mature tree canopy, while beautiful, poses a risk of falling limbs during the intense thunderstorms or occasional ice storms we experience. A good insurer will guide you on coverage for such events and may even recommend preventative tree maintenance. The value of Beacon's real estate market has seen significant appreciation, especially in neighborhoods like the East End or along Main Street. This makes it imperative to work with house insurance companies that regularly reassess dwelling coverage limits to keep pace with local rebuilding costs. A policy written five years ago might not account for today's higher labor and material expenses, particularly for restoring historic details. It's wise to seek insurers who offer extended or guaranteed replacement cost coverage. Additionally, many Beacon homes feature unique elements like original hardwood floors, stained glass, or updated artisan kitchens. Standard policies may undervalue these features, so discussing scheduled personal property endorsements for high-value items is a conversation to have with prospective providers. When evaluating house insurance companies, consider their local presence and claims response reputation. A company with adjusters familiar with the area can process claims more efficiently after a regional event. Engage with neighbors in community forums or local social media groups for firsthand recommendations. Always obtain multiple quotes, but prioritize clarity on policy details over the lowest premium. Ask specific questions about coverage for sump pump failure, identity theft if you run a home-based business (common in Beacon's creative economy), and liability limits suitable for hosting guests, given our city's popularity as a weekend destination. Ultimately, the best house insurance companies for Beacon homeowners are those that view your policy as a dynamic partnership, offering not just a financial safety net but also proactive risk management advice tailored to life in this special riverside city.
